Output 787eb26852341ce76e51d1565a695750ce5f33880b5e9ce912d1fc33c6b3d3a3:0

value
884864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1eabf08957e0031b164b986a9502883fa6cec118 OP_EQUAL
address
34VCAsV1gUvqa3JLaHEiUSBrFLzEjKWeB3
transaction
787eb26852341ce76e51d1565a695750ce5f33880b5e9ce912d1fc33c6b3d3a3
spent
true